Pacifist Memorial dedicating nine new plaques

The Pacifist Memorial, located on 2 North Main St., Sherborn, has announced the dedication of nine additional bronze plaques at the Pacifist Memorial: Muhammad Ali, Howard Zinn, Maya Angelou, Daniel Berrigan, Betsy Sawyer, Jeanette Rankin, Rachel Corrie, Corbett Bishopand Kenneth and Elise Boulding. Six of the individuals honored were recipients of the Courage of Conscience Award and visited the Abbey and Memorial over the years.

The event is co-sponsored by The Peace Abbey, Walpole Peace and Justice Group, Natick Common Street Spiritual Center and The Life Experience School.

The dedication will take place on Sunday, July 29, at 2 p.m. During this special ceremony, internationally-renowned artist Lado Goudjabidze, who created the Gandhi statue in 1994, will be rededicating the statue to the next generation of peacemakers. Local schoolchildren are invited to attend and accept from him the original miniature model of the Gandhi statue.
